Winter hiking on the Hoher Kranzberg near Mittenwald

Winter hikes

Start: Mittenwald, Talstation Kranzberg-Sessellift - Destination: Mittenwald, Talstation Kranzberg-Sessellift

An extended winter hike on the Hoher Kranzberg promises wintertime fun for the whole family in the deep snow. This interesting loop leads from the base station of the Kranzberg chair lift to the Kranzberg summit (1,391 m) and back to the starting point via the Lautersee lake.

Tour description

This winter hike to the summit of Hoher Kranzberg (1,391 m) near Mittenwald begins at the base station of the Kranzberg chair lift. The winter hiking trail 830 begins directly adjacent to the base station and leads up to the Saint Anton alpine tavern (1,223 m), where refreshments are available. After visiting the alpine tavern, hikers will continue to follow the ascent to the Kranzberg summit (1,391 m), which can be reached in about 1 ½ hours. Here, you can enjoy the unique view of the mountain peaks of the Karwendel range and then begin the descent back to the St. Anton alpine tavern and on down through the snow-covered alpine forest of the Kranzberg to the Lautersee lake. Hikers can return to the base station of the Kranzberg chair lift either via the Geological Educational Trail or the picturesque Laintal valley.
